#4e6380 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e6380 is composed of 30.6% red, 38.8%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.1% cyan, 22.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 214.8 degrees, a saturation of 24.3% and a lightness of 40.4%. #4e6380 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cc6ff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#4e6380 color description : Mostly desaturated dark blue.
#4e6380 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e6380 has RGB values of R:78, G:99,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 5137280.

Shades and Tints of #4e6380
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040506 is the darkest color, while #f9faf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e6380
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666768 is the less saturated color, while #0758c7 is the most saturated one.
